  1. Alliant Computer Systems

    Notability date April 2009 Unreferenced date April 2009 Alliant Computer Systems was a computer company that designed and manufactured parallel computing systems. Together with Pyramid Technology and Sequent Computer Systems , Alliant s machines pioneered the symmetric multiprocessing market. One of the more successful companies in the group, over 650 Alliant systems were produced over their lifetime. History 1980s Alliant was founded, as Dataflow Systems, in May 1982 by Ron Gruner, Craig Mundie and Rich McAndrew to produce machines for scientific and engineering users who needed smaller, less costly machines than offerings from Cray Computer and similar high end vendors. Machines that addressed this market segment later became known as Minisupercomputer minisupercomputers . Alliant s first machines were announced in 1985, starting with the FX series. The FX series consisted of a number Computational Elements, or CEs, which included a set of Weitek 1064 1065 floating point unit FPU s and several custom designed support chips to implement a vector processor based upon the popular Motorola 68000 family Motorola 68000 architecture.   1. Movement Systems Drum Computer

    Spelling UK Unreferenced date April 2007 The Movement Drum System I II generally referred to as the Movement MCS Percussion Computer was a very rare British made drum machine produced approximately 1981 MKI and 1983 MKII . Both retailed at 1999.00 ex vat at march 1983 from Movement Audio Visual , 61 Taunton Road, Bridgwater, Somerset, TA6 3LP, UK. Both models combined two technologies analogue synthesized drum sounds similar to Simmons SDS V and basic digital digitized 8 bit drum samples. In total 14 independent voice modules could be played 5 of which can be digital . Also notable for its computer like design and its ability to display drum notes and sequencing graphically on a green black cathode ray tube display unit perhaps similar to page R on the fairlight CMI . The Movement Drum Systems are known to have been expensive upon release, and it is estimated that approximately thirty were made. The original designers was John Dickenson owned the company Movement and Dave Goodway. John Dickenson supplied sounds and the idea the Design, Look, how it should work, layout etc. and Dave Goodway did the electronic side of the drum machine. Its most famous user was David A. Stewart of Eurythmics , who excelled in the use of this Drum Computer on their 1983 worldwide hit, Sweet Dreams Are Made of This song Sweet Dreams Are Made Of This . The machine MKI makes an appearance in the video, in a scene in which singer Annie Lennox is seated on top of a table in a meadow, as Dave Stewart types on the Drum Computer s keyboard. Note in this video the version used is a two piece type base unit and separate monitor perhaps a prototype or the MKI model . Phil Collins used an orange smaller one piece MKII.   1. The Public-Access Computer Systems Review

    cleanup date October 2010 wikify date October 2010 The Public Access Computer Systems Review abbreviated PACS Review was an electronic academic journal journal about end user computer systems in library libraries . A brief history of the journal It was established in 1989 by Charles W. Bailey, Jr., who served as Editor in Chief for volumes one 1990 to seven 1996 . It was published by the University of Houston Libraries. The establishment of the journal was announced on the PACS L list on August 16, 1989. A call for papers was issued on October 16, 1989. The publication of the first issue was announced on January 3, 1990. The journal was cataloged on OCLC on February 1, 1990 record number 20987125 by the Library of Congress National Serials Data Program it was assigned an ISSN number at the same time . Initially, the journal published scholarly papers Communications section , columns, and reviews. Papers in the Communications section were selected by the Editor in Chief and the Associate Editor, Communications. A private mailing list was utilized for communication with editorial staff and Editorial Board members. Most communication with authors was done via e mail, including paper submission. The PACS Review was published three times a year.   1. Re Atlantic Computer Systems (No 1)

    Infobox Court Case name Re Atlantic Computer Systems plc No 1 court Court of Appeal image caption date decided full name citations 1992 Ch 505 judges prior actions subsequent actions opinions transcripts keywords Administration law Administration Re Atlantic Computer Systems plc No 1 1992 Ch 505 is a UK insolvency law case concerning the administration procedure when a company is unable to repay its debts. Facts Atlantic Computer Systems had hired a set of computers. The company lending the computers attempted to repossess them. Judgment The Court of Appeal held that the computers could not be repossessed directly. The landlords and hire purchase sellers could not get money as an expense of administrative receivership either, because the lessor or owner of goods has his remedies. Nicholls LJ gave guidance on exercising security rights against companies in administration. Referring to the old s 11, he said the following. ref 1992 Ch 505, 541 4 ref Cquote Typically, when lending money to a company, a bank will take as security a charge over all or most of the assets of the company, present and future, the charge being a fixed charge on land and certain other assets, and a floating charge over the remaining assets. The deed authorises the bank to appoint a receiver and manager of the company s undertaking with power to carry on the company s business. Such a receiver is referred to in the Act of 1986 as an administrative receiver. ... We feel bound, therefore, to make some general observations regarding cases where leave is sought to exercise existing proprietary rights, including security rights, against a company in administration. 1 It is in every case for the person who seeks leave to make out a case for him to be given leave. 2 The prohibition in section 11 3 c and d is intended to assist the company, under the management of the administrator, to achieve the purpose for which the administration order was made.
